Light as the vessels journeying the waves



Zitat
Take the blade of the Foam-riders with thee, Grey Wizard. It is silver, light as our vessels that voyage beyond the blue, yet dreadful token for whom dareth hinder the will of the Western Lords. Thou shalt bear it, along thy hazardous journeys and whither thy mission is to lead thee, until thy hand shall wield a mightier craft, made by grievous exiled and borne by a king dwelling in legend.



This piece is part of a more elaborate proposal of the forum, of which this passage explores the fictional lore and founds those premises that are needed for the economy of the very story: not only is Gandalf gifted the Ring of Fire by Círdan, but the Guardian of the Havens bestowed a mighty blade upon the wizard; item which, as the old Elf had foreseen, is to serve the Istar's cause greatly, until Gandalf is led to discover another blade from the forgotten places of the world. A sword that lies abandoned and forsaken, albeit it being blessed by the legend of a heroic past.

A clarification on the title given to the Teleri ('Foam-riders') is necessary: it is a word from Tolkien himself and just tells the reader how the Elven kind, to whom the sea is dearest, boasts unsurpassed skills in naval craft and sea voyages.
